Just a few blocks from the Democratic National Convention sits 90-year-old Moon’s Sandwich Shop, a local business that survived the Great Depression and Covid-19 and is now struggling to keep its doors open.

FOX Business’ Kelly Saberi visited the Generations Store and spoke with owner Jim Radek about the recent economic problems the business has faced.

The old saying was 4 to 1. If it costs you what it costs you, raise the price fourfold. So, just for argument’s sake, if corned beef costs me $10 a pound and I sell a sandwich for half a pound, that’s $5. The sandwich should really cost $20, but it doesn’t,” owner Jim Radek, who has owned the store for more than 40 years, told Saberi on Thursday.

Radek further explained that the area where his shop is located was considered a “food desert” until recently, when a grocery store opened across the street. Moon’s Sandwich Shop was a major food supplier to area residents, but rising costs have put his business in unprecedented trouble.

Out of concern for the welfare of the community, Radek was hesitant to raise food prices in his store, although he admitted that it was difficult to keep prices low when the cost of goods was constantly fluctuating.

Rising wages are also putting a strain on Radek’s business. The minimum wage in Chicago is currently $16.20 an hour. In 2023, it will be $15.80.

Radek invited politicians who were at the United Center just blocks away to come and talk to his customers and enjoy a sandwich.
